| # This script generates a Python interface for an Apple Macintosh Manager.
 | |
| # It uses the "bgen" package to generate C code.
 | |
| # The function specifications are generated by scanning the mamager's header file,
 | |
| # using the "scantools" package (customized for this particular manager).
 | |
| 
 | |
| import string
 | |
| 
 | |
| import addpack
 | |
| addpack.addpack(':Tools:bgen:bgen')
 | |
| 
 | |
| # Declarations that change for each manager
 | |
| MACHEADERFILE = 'Controls.h'		# The Apple header file
 | |
| MODNAME = 'Ctl'				# The name of the module
 | |
| OBJECTNAME = 'Control'			# The basic name of the objects used here
 | |
| 
 | |
| # The following is *usually* unchanged but may still require tuning
 | |
| MODPREFIX = MODNAME			# The prefix for module-wide routines
 | |
| OBJECTTYPE = OBJECTNAME + 'Handle'	# The C type used to represent them
 | |
| OBJECTPREFIX = MODPREFIX + 'Obj'	# The prefix for object methods
 | |
| INPUTFILE = string.lower(MODPREFIX) + 'gen.py' # The file generated by the scanner
 | |
| OUTPUTFILE = MODNAME + "module.c"	# The file generated by this program
 | |
| 
 | |
| from macsupport import *
 | |
| 
 | |
| # Create the type objects
 | |
| 
 | |
| ControlHandle = OpaqueByValueType(OBJECTTYPE, OBJECTPREFIX)
 | |
| ControlRef = ControlHandle
 | |
| ExistingControlHandle = OpaqueByValueType(OBJECTTYPE, "CtlObj_WhichControl", "BUG")
 | |
| 
 | |
| RgnHandle = OpaqueByValueType("RgnHandle", "ResObj")
 | |
| CCTabHandle = OpaqueByValueType("CCTabHandle", "ResObj")
 | |
| AuxCtlHandle = OpaqueByValueType("AuxCtlHandle", "ResObj")
 | |
| ControlPartCode = Type("ControlPartCode", "h")
 | |
| DragConstraint = Type("DragConstraint", "h")
 | |
| ControlVariant = Type("ControlVariant", "h")
 | |
| IconTransformType = Type("IconTransformType", "h")
 | |
| ControlButtonGraphicAlignment = Type("ControlButtonGraphicAlignment", "h")
 | |
| ControlButtonTextAlignment = Type("ControlButtonTextAlignment", "h")
 | |
| ControlButtonTextPlacement = Type("ControlButtonTextPlacement", "h")
 | |
| ControlContentType = Type("ControlContentType", "h")
 | |
| ControlFocusPart = Type("ControlFocusPart", "h")
 | |
| 
 | |
| ControlFontStyleRec = OpaqueType('ControlFontStyleRec', 'ControlFontStyle')
 | |
| ControlFontStyleRec_ptr = ControlFontStyleRec
